Course Details
• Introduction to Pharmacogenomics: Understanding the basics of pharmacogenomics, its importance, and how it contributes to personalized medicine.
• Genetic Basis of Drug Response: Exploring the genetic variations that influence drug response, including single nucleotide polymorphisms (SNPs) and copy number variations (CNVs).
• Pharmacogenomics Testing: Examining the methods, benefits, and limitations of pharmacogenomics testing for clinical decision-making.
• Pharmacogenomics in Clinical Practice: Investigating the implementation of pharmacogenomics in clinical settings, including the integration of pharmacogenomics information into electronic health records.
• Ethical, Legal, and Social Issues in Pharmacogenomics: Discussing the ethical, legal, and social implications of pharmacogenomics, including patient privacy, data security, and informed consent.
• Global Health Initiatives: Examining global health initiatives and their impact on healthcare systems, including the World Health Organization (WHO) and the United Nations (UN).
• Global Health Policy and Financing: Investigating global health policy and financing, including the role of governments, non-governmental organizations (NGOs), and private sector actors.
• Global Health Challenges and Solutions: Discussing global health challenges such as infectious diseases, non-communicable diseases, and health system weaknesses, and exploring potential solutions.
• Cross-cultural Communication in Global Health: Understanding the importance of cross-cultural communication in global health and developing skills for effective communication with diverse populations.
• Global Health Leadership and Management: Exploring leadership and management principles and practices for effective global health programs and initiatives.
